Output faaeb873f087aca190c7ba836fd7712d6b876f1cd6b0b6c69e8f72a71982c6cb:0

value
5903113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3649132fb61986dbedd768da1af82621653f7358 OP_EQUAL
address
36e3xEowmqwYVbZXgc2W5SN6wwhoHmA1Jd
transaction
faaeb873f087aca190c7ba836fd7712d6b876f1cd6b0b6c69e8f72a71982c6cb
confirmations
250385
spent
true